Amundi grew its holdings in shares of Archrock, Inc. (NYSE:AROC - Free Report) by 194.2%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The firm owned 95,810 shares of the energy company's stock after purchasing an additional 63,241 shares during the period. Amundi owned approximately 0.05% of Archrock worth $2,427,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Archrock,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ates as an energy infrastructure company in the United States. The company operates in two segments, Contract Operations and Aftermarket Services. It engages in the designing, sourcing, owning, installing, operating, servicing, repairing, and maintaining of its owned fleet of natural gas compression equipment to provide natural gas compression services.
